Multiple Choice

For one product that a firm produces,the manufacturing cycle efficiency is 25 percent.If the total production time is 10 hours,what is the total manufacturing time?


A) 2.5 hours
B) 8.0 hours
C) 10.0 hours
D) 40.0 hours
